description | This dataset includes land use/cover change data with a spatial resolution of 300 m, net ecosystem productivity data based on the monthly grid data of the temperature and precipitation series data from the Climatic Research Unit, terrestrial net primary production data from MOD17 of the Central Asia that underlies the article entitled “Spatial patterns of vegetation carbon sinks and sources under water constraint in Central Asia”. We explain the details of the dataset, the data harmonization procedures, and the spatial coverage. We also provide the validation result of NPP data from MOD17. We unified the spatiotemporal resolution of these data from different sources, based on re-sampling (nearest neighbor interpolation) and re-classification techniques, and combined the data from the different source datasets to form comprehensive records. |
